Planning for the future can be daunting, but ensuring your loved ones are well-provided for is a vital step. Life insurance provides a safety net, offering financial peace of mind in case of an unforeseen event. There are various types of life insurance policies available, each with its own set of benefits and features.

Term life insurance, for example, provides financial support during a defined timeframe. It's often budget-friendly and ideal for covering short-term needs like funeral expenses.

Whole life insurance, on the other hand, offers lifetime coverage. These policies often accumulate cash value, making them a suitable choice for long-term goals like retirement planning or providing for future generations.

Performance Bonds: Protecting Parties in Contracts and Agreements

Surety bonds perform as a critical mechanism for mitigating risk in contractual deals. When one party enters into an agreement with another, a surety bond provides financial guarantee that the obligated party will adhere to the terms of the contract. This safety is vital for each parties involved, as it minimizes the potential for financial damage in the event of a default.

Importance of Apostille Certification for Global Transactions

In the realm of international business and legal proceedings, ensuring authenticity and recognition of documents is paramount. An apostille certification plays a pivotal role in achieving this objective. This legal seal of approval, issued by designated authorities, attests to the genuineness of a document's origin and its conformity with relevant laws and regulations.
